This work is the biography of basketball star Rod Hundley, who broke every scoring record at West Virginia University and twice made the all-American team. He was a crowd pleaser with his trick shots. His professional career was with the Minneapolis, and later Los Angeles, Lakers. Photographs are included. This copy is clean and solid.
